Trillium Floral Designs is an Ottawa wedding florist operating as a studio-based floral design company after closing its March Road retail storefront. The business says it serves Ottawa and the National Capital Region and continues to take bookings for weddings, alongside sympathy services, corporate installations and special events.
For couples planning an intimate celebration, the studio’s wedding page points to a particular fit: funky, unique florals, offbeat themes and unusual colour schemes. Its stated process begins with a wedding questionnaire, followed by an initial quote and then a more detailed quote if the couple chooses to proceed. Trillium Floral Designs describes itself as a floral design studio for weddings and events. On its wedding page, the company says it specialises in intimate weddings and focuses on funky and unique florals. It invites enquiries from couples with offbeat concepts, including unusual colour schemes or themed celebrations, and says its designers use their knowledge of available flowers to select unique, fresh blooms for the day.
The official site also lists sympathy services, corporate installations and special events among its current areas of work. Those offerings establish that the business works beyond weddings, but couples should use the wedding enquiry route for wedding-specific planning and scope.
The company says it works across Ottawa and the National Capital Region. Its corporate page also says it is located near Kanata North’s High Tech Hub, but the official site does not publish a current studio street address for clients. The former March Road storefront is explicitly described as closed, so this listing does not present the legacy address as an active walk-in location.
This may suit couples holding an Ottawa-area wedding who want a florist comfortable with creative direction and who are planning a smaller or intimate event. The company names several favourite venues, including The Marshes Golf Club, Brookstreet Hotel and Stonefields; this is useful context, not a statement that it is affiliated with or available at those venues.
A documented strength is the studio’s clear creative positioning. Its wedding page specifically welcomes offbeat themes and unusual colour schemes, while the main site describes an award-winning team known for modern, artful arrangements and attention to detail. The site also says it supports local flower growers and suppliers whenever possible.
The main practical limitation is that the business is no longer a retail storefront. Couples should therefore confirm how consultation, delivery, installation, pickup and any venue coordination would work for their date and location. The official site does not publish a current public address, a wedding package list or a catalogue of included floral pieces.
Current pricing is not explicitly published. The company does state that it is accepting wedding, event and funeral-service orders with a minimum order of $500.
For wedding enquiries, the published process is to submit the questionnaire first. The company says it then sends a quick quote so a couple can assess budget fit; after a green light, it prepares a detailed quote. That makes the $500 figure a minimum order, not a complete wedding price or a guarantee of availability.
The official contact page lists 613-599-6849 and asks callers to leave a detailed message. It also lists info@trilliumfloral.ca for enquiries. For a wedding, the site directs couples to the wedding page and its questionnaire rather than the general contact route.
When getting in touch, include the wedding date, venue or location, approximate event scale, preferred palette or style, and inspiration images if available. The company’s corporate enquiry instructions specifically ask for event date, time, location and floral requirements; those are sensible details to confirm for a wedding as well, while the wedding questionnaire remains the official starting point.
Before committing, ask whether your date is available and whether the $500 minimum is appropriate for the floral scope you have in mind. Confirm the detailed quote, payment schedule, consultation format, delivery or installation arrangements, setup and teardown responsibilities, and whether any rented vessels or structures are involved.
It is also worth sharing your venue, priorities and inspiration early. Because the company highlights creative freedom and non-traditional concepts, couples can ask how much design direction is needed, what seasonal substitutions may be made, and how the plan will be adapted to the venue. Request confirmation in writing of the final floral items, quantities, timelines and logistics.
